There are two types of bug with worm AI mobs:
  • Some have to be killed by a head shot or they don't show up on the tally, this is why Crawltipedes are stuck at 0, as they can only be killed by hitting their tail. Bone serpents, giant worms, tomb crawlers and dune splicers are also on this list
  • Some worms are showing KCA, but they still drop banners. I had the same issue with devourers but then I killed one and got it's banner.

There are three things that took me a while to get used to, and still find annoying:

  1. When in a chest, tapping R1 takes you to the main inventory, but tapping L1 doesn't take you back to the chest, but to the "list" crafting menu. This is irritating when you're trying to quickly/smoothly equip things from a chest and vice versa.
  2. When equipping items, we have the ability to go through both crafting menus with the item we want to rquip. This makes no sense, as it can't be dropped into either crafting menu; it just serves to take us where we don't want to go.
  3. Pressing L2 to equip something is great, but only if you want to euip one item. Any more than one and things get really confusing. Example:

    > I press L2 on a shield to equip it
    > I press L2 on a lucky coin to equip it, and it takes the place of the shield I just equipped, which goes back into the inventory/chest
    > I press L2 on the spore sac, and it replaces the lucky coin, which goes back into the inventory/chest
    >Rinse & repeat
